couchette Definition

cou·chette (ko̵̅o̅ s̸het)

noun

an inexpensive berth on a European train, consisting of a shelflike bed that folds down to allow passengers to sleep in their clothes: there are usually four couchettes in a first-class compartment and six in a second-class compartment
